> Description:
> phpWebApp is an application framework which makes easy and simple the task of 
> building PHP web applications based on relational databases. It separates the 
> task of designing and changing the layout of the application from the task of 
> implementing the logic of the application, by using XML templates that are an 
> extension of XHTML. It also simplifies the task of implementing the logic of 
> the application by offering an event based programming model. In addition, 
> phpWebApp tries to offer modularity and code reusability to the community of 
> webApp developers.

 Please remove GIF image files from your project and
replace them with an other format (such as PNG or JPEG).

Because of the patents (Unisys and IBM) covering the LZW
compression algorithm which are used when making GIF files,
it's impossible to have free software to generate proper
GIFs.  They also apply to the compress program.

For more information read http://www.gnu.org/philosophy/gif.html

Before releasing your project under the GPL, please place
copyright notices and permission to copy statements at the beginning
of every file of source code.  

In addition, if you haven't already, please copy a copy of the plain
text version of the GPL, available from
(http://www.gnu.org/licenses/gpl.txt), into a file named "COPYING".

Additional instructions are available from
http://www.gnu.org/licenses/gpl-howto.html.

The GPL FAQ explains why these procedures must be followed.  To learn
why a copy of the GPL must be included with every copy of the code,
for example, go to
http://www.gnu.org/licenses/gpl-faq.html#WhyMustIInclude
